!!omap
- USB0_CAPLENGTH:
    fields: !!omap
    - CAPLENGTH:
        access: r
        description: Indicates offset to add to the register base address at the beginning
          of the Operational Register
        lsb: 0
        reset_value: '0x40'
        width: 8
    - HCIVERSION:
        access: r
        description: BCD encoding of the EHCI revision number supported by this host
          controller
        lsb: 8
        reset_value: '0x100'
        width: 16
- USB0_HCSPARAMS:
    fields: !!omap
    - N_PORTS:
        access: r
        description: Number of downstream ports
        lsb: 0
        reset_value: '0x1'
        width: 4
    - PPC:
        access: r
        description: Port Power Control
        lsb: 4
        reset_value: '0x1'
        width: 1
    - N_PCC:
        access: r
        description: Number of Ports per Companion Controller
        lsb: 8
        reset_value: '0x0'
        width: 4
    - N_CC:
        access: r
        description: Number of Companion Controller
        lsb: 12
        reset_value: '0x0'
        width: 4
    - PI:
        access: r
        description: Port indicators
        lsb: 16
        reset_value: '0x1'
        width: 1
    - N_PTT:
        access: r
        description: Number of Ports per Transaction Translator
        lsb: 20
        reset_value: '0x0'
        width: 4
    - N_TT:
        access: r
        description: Number of Transaction Translators
        lsb: 24
        reset_value: '0x0'
        width: 4
- USB0_HCCPARAMS:
    fields: !!omap
    - ADC:
        access: r
        description: 64-bit Addressing Capability
        lsb: 0
        reset_value: '0'
        width: 1
    - PFL:
        access: r
        description: Programmable Frame List Flag
        lsb: 1
        reset_value: '1'
        width: 1
    - ASP:
        access: r
        description: Asynchronous Schedule Park Capability
        lsb: 2
        reset_value: '1'
        width: 1
    - IST:
        access: r
        description: Isochronous Scheduling Threshold
        lsb: 4
        reset_value: '0'
        width: 4
    - EECP:
        access: r
        description: EHCI Extended Capabilities Pointer
        lsb: 8
        reset_value: '0'
        width: 4
- USB0_DCCPARAMS:
    fields: !!omap
    - DEN:
        access: r
        description: Device Endpoint Number
        lsb: 0
        reset_value: '0x4'
        width: 5
    - DC:
        access: r
        description: Device Capable
        lsb: 7
        reset_value: '0x1'
        width: 1
    - HC:
        access: r
        description: Host Capable
        lsb: 8
        reset_value: '0x1'
        width: 1
- USB0_USBCMD_D:
    fields: !!omap
    - RS:
        access: rw
        description: Run/Stop
        lsb: 0
        reset_value: '0'
        width: 1
    - RST:
        access: rw
        description: Controller reset
        lsb: 1
        reset_value: '0'
        width: 1
    - SUTW:
        access: rw
        description: Setup trip wire
        lsb: 13
        reset_value: '0'
        width: 1
    - ATDTW:
        access: rw
        description: Add dTD trip wire
        lsb: 14
        reset_value: '0'
        width: 1
    - ITC:
        access: rw
        description: Interrupt threshold control
        lsb: 16
        reset_value: '0x8'
        width: 8
- USB0_USBCMD_H:
    fields: !!omap
    - RS:
        access: rw
        description: Run/Stop
        lsb: 0
        reset_value: '0'
        width: 1
    - RST:
        access: rw
        description: Controller reset
        lsb: 1
        reset_value: '0'
        width: 1
    - FS0:
        access: ''
        description: Bit 0 of the Frame List Size bits
        lsb: 2
        reset_value: '0'
        width: 1
    - FS1:
        access: ''
        description: Bit 1 of the Frame List Size bits
        lsb: 3
        reset_value: '0'
        width: 1
    - PSE:
        access: rw
        description: This bit controls whether the host controller skips processing
          the periodic schedule
        lsb: 4
        reset_value: '0'
        width: 1
    - ASE:
        access: rw
        description: This bit controls whether the host controller skips processing
          the asynchronous schedule
        lsb: 5
        reset_value: '0'
        width: 1
    - IAA:
        access: rw
        description: This bit is used as a doorbell by software to tell the host controller
          to issue an interrupt the next time it advances asynchronous schedule
        lsb: 6
        reset_value: '0'
        width: 1
    - ASP1_0:
        access: rw
        description: Asynchronous schedule park mode
        lsb: 8
        reset_value: '0x3'
        width: 2
    - ASPE:
        access: rw
        description: Asynchronous Schedule Park Mode Enable
        lsb: 11
        reset_value: '1'
        width: 1
    - FS2:
        access: ''
        description: Bit 2 of the Frame List Size bits
        lsb: 15
        reset_value: '0'
        width: 1
    - ITC:
        access: rw
        description: Interrupt threshold control
        lsb: 16
        reset_value: '0x8'
        width: 8
